INTRODUCTION

2.1

Introduction

Vroom is a family of user interfaces that support the CAN bus.
The devices can be used with the controllers of the family C-PRO 3; the user interface loads the pages of the controller and refreshes the value of
the shown variables with "browser" technology.
The user interface is made of a 128 x 64 pixel single colour LCD graphic display (black with rearlighting through white LED) and a 6 buttons (with
preset functions) membrane keyboard.
The instruments also have got:
• real time clock and alarm buzzer.
It also incorporates a temperature sensor or a temperature and humidity sensor; the values read by these sensors are transmitted via CAN bus,
making easier the wiring.
Mounting is:
• panel mounting
• built-in mounting, in traditional box (like "506" by BTicino)
• wall mounting, through the support CPVW00 (to order separately).
Fixing screws are always supplied by the builder.
To the front of the devices can be applied the plates CPVP** (to order separately) made of plastic material, available in two different colorations
(white and black); because of their constructive and fixing features, can also be applied the plates series "Living" and "Light" by BTicino.
Through the gasket 0027000007 (to order separately) it is also possible to increase the frontal protection degree.

4

ELECTRICAL CONNECTION

4.1

Electrical connection

Position micro-switch 4 on position ON to plug in the termination of
the CAN port; micro-switches 1, 2 and 3 are reserved.
Connector 1: CAN port.

PIN

MEANING

1

ground

2

signal -

3

signal +

Also look at the baud rate of the CAN port of the controller.
Connector 2: power supply (12-24 VAC/DC isolated or
24 VAC/DC non isolated, according to the model).

PIN

MEANING

4

power supply

5

power supply

4.2

Additional information for electrical connection

• do not operate on the terminal blocks with electrical or pneumatic

screwers

• if the instrument has been moved from a cold location to a warm

one, the humidity could condense on the inside; wait about an hour
before supplying it

• test the working power supply voltage, working electrical frequency

and working electrical power of the instrument; they must corre-
spond with the local power supply

• connect the user interface to the controller using a twisted pair
• disconnect the local power supply before servicing the instrument
• do not use the instrument as safety device
• for repairs and information on the instrument please contact Evco

sales network.

5

TECHNICAL DATA

5.1

Technical data

Purpose of control: user interface for programmable controllers.
Construction of control: electronic device to be incorporated.
Box: self-extinguishing transparent.
Size: 118.0 x 111.0 x 26.7 mm (4.645 x 4.370 x 1.051 in).
Size refers to the instrument with connector 1 and connector 2 prop-
erly plugged.
Installation: installation is:
• panel mounting
• built-in mounting, in traditional box (like “506” by BTicino)
• wall mounting, through the support CPVW00 (to order separately);

look at chapter 7.

Fixing screws are always supplied by the builder.
To the front of the devices can be applied the plates CPVP** (to order
separately) made of plastic material, available in two different colora-
tions (white and black); look at chapter 6.
Frontal protection: IP40 (IP65 for panel mounting with gasket
0027000007, to order separately).
Connections: extractable male + female terminal blocks (power sup-
ply and CAN port), 6 poles telephone connector (programming port).
The maximum length of the connecting cables depends on the baud
rate of the CAN port of the controller:
• 1,000 m (3,280 ft) with baud rate 20,000 baud
• 500 m (1,640 ft) with baud rate 50,000 baud
• 250 m (820 ft) with baud rate 125,000 baud
• 50 m (164 ft) with baud rate 500,000 baud.
The user interface recognizes the local CAN port baud rate of the con-
troller automatically.
Working temperature: from 0 to 50 °C (32 to 120 °F, 10 ... 90% of
relative humidity without condensate).
Pollution situation: 2 or more.
Power supply: according to the model:
• 12-24 VAC (min. 11.4 VAC, max. 27.6 VAC), 50/60 Hz, 3 VA (approxi-

mate) isolated or 15 ... 40 VDC, 3 W (approximate) isolated

• 24 VAC (min. 20.4 VAC, max. 27.6 VAC), 50/60 Hz, 3 VA (approxi-

mate) non isolated or 20 ... 40 VDC, 2 W (approximate) non isolated

supplied from a class 2 circuit.
Protect the power supply with an UL listed or recognized fuse rated:
• 80 mA-T if the user interface is powered with 15... 40 VDC
• 160 mA-T if the user interface is powered with 12... 19 VAC
• 125 mA-T if the user interface is powered with 19... 24 VAC.
Overvoltage category: III.
Real time clock data maintenance in absence of power sup-
ply: 2 days will battery fully charged.
Battery charge time: 2 min without interruptions (the battery is
charged by the power supply of the user interface).
Alarm buzzer: incorporated.
Sensor: incorporated, according to the model:
• temperature sensor
• temperature and humidity sensor.
Temperature sensor working range (and accuracy): from
-10 to 70 °C (±1.5 °C).
Humidity sensor working range (and accuracy): from
5 to 95% of relative humidity (±3% of relative humidity from 20 to
80%, ±5% otherwise).
Display: 128 x 64 pixel single colour LCD graphic display (black with
rearlighting through white LED).
Communication ports: 1 non optoisolated CAN port.
